The Demo Framework highlights powerful features created by the Drupal community and is intended to be used as a starterkit for promoting enterprise-ready Drupal solutions.

This project is a Demo Framework Scenario for Drupal PM module. Read more about Demo Framework here.


Drupal PM Demo (dfs_pm)

Project Management scenario focussed on showcasing the power of Drupal PM (Project Management).

Requirements

There are two ways to enable the Drupal PM Demo.

Manual Install

Before installing Demo Framework, make sure you download all the dependencies. Select "Drupal PM Demo" when time comes to select a Demo Framework Scenario during profile installation.

Drush Install

Simply call the DF Enable Scenario command via drush pointing to the desired scenario's machine name. $ drush df-es dfs_pm

Note:

After the Sandbox is created in simplytest.me, you will have to do the following to import demo contents.

Lets say after installing the demo on simplytest.me,
the site url is www.example.com

STEP 1: Visit www.example.com/user/login.
        Use the following credential to log in.
        username: admin
        password: admin

STEP 2: Visit www.example.com/admin/df.
        There should be a section called "Drupal PM Demo".
        Click on the "Reset" link.

STEP 3: Wait for the import to finish. 

STEP 4: After the import,
        you can vist Frontpage and start interacting with Drupal PM.
        Visit www.example.com/admin/people to see list of users and roles 
        that Demo have created.
        The password for all the users created by the demo is "password"
